EEOC Chair Attends Meeting of Interagency Task Force to Monitor and Combat Trafficking in Persons

On March 15, 2012, EEOC Chair Jacqueline Berrien participated in a meeting at the White House of the Interagency Task Force to Monitor and Combat Human Trafficking. The Task Force includes several members of President Barack Obama's cabinet and senior advisors, and is chaired by Secretary of State Hillary Clinton.

The EEOC is a natural partner in the struggle against modern-day slavery, and is working across the country with vulnerable populations to protect one of the most basic of their human and civil rights – the right to equal employment opportunity. The agency is working with partners across federal, state and local levels to enhance the enforcement of laws to protect trafficked workers, and will continue to work to end this unspeakable cruelty.
